If you had health insurance through the Health Insurance Marketplace (https://www.healthcare.gov/) or your state's marketplace, the calculators don't seem to support reconciling the premium tax credit. For that, you can use a combination of information from your Health Insurance Marketplace account and https://www.taxformcalculator.com/calculator/8962.html to find the amount you underpaid or overpaid.
